用于WinForms的Telerik UI
WinForms的SpreadProcessing是一个文档处理库,允许您使用c#和VB处理电子表格文档。net可以从头创建新文档,修改现有文档或在最常见的电子表格格式之间进行转换。您可以将生成的工作簿保存到本地文件、流或流到客户端浏览器。
该库模型密切遵循Office Open XML规范中定义的已建立的文档标准,并支持. net Framework、. net Core和. net standard。
WinForms SpreadProcessing的操作独立于外部库或UI。处理Microsoft Excel文档,而无需在客户端或服务器上安装Microsoft Excel、Microsoft Office或任何其他电子表格软件。
WinForms SpreadProcessing Library的Telerik UI支持流行的文件扩展名和电子表格格式,包括XLSX (Excel工作簿),XLS (Excel 97-2003工作簿),CSV,纯文本和PDF(仅导出)。该API还允许您轻松地将数据表对象转换为工作表,反之亦然,以防您需要使用来自数据库的数据。
工作簿模型允许您控制不同的行和列参数。API提供了手动定义它们的宽度和高度的选项,或者使用AutoFit功能根据内容自动计算行和列的大小。您还可以设置可见性属性,允许用户隐藏电子表格中的行和列。
单元格是工作表的核心数据单元。利用一组完整的选项来处理单元格,包括设置它们的值和格式化属性。您可以允许用户更改单元格填充,边框,字体,换行,数字格式,文本旋转缩进和许多更多的属性。单元格值类型可以方便地处理任何类型的数据。
对整个列和行单元格引用的支持包括对绝对、相对和混合单元格引用的支持,例如$1:$2和A:D。例如,当您需要处理一系列单元格并将它们传递到公式中时,所有这些都很方便。
SpreadProcessing库有现成的数字格式,可以应用于单元格值。选择从我们的预定义格式,包括数字,货币,日期,时间和文本,或创建自己的自定义格式。
公式帮助计算电子表格中单元格的值。享受超过200个内置函数,并能够轻松插入自定义公式,只要你需要。
您可以通过专用的API在工作表中插入、定位和删除图像。
用图表帮助用户更好地理解数据。WinForms的SpreadProcessing使您能够添加用户可以选择的广泛的图表类型,包括线,柱状,柱状,散点,气泡,饼状,甜甜圈,区域以及组合图表或不同的系列。
插入和删除注释功能允许添加关于单元格的信息、回复注释或删除注释。关于创建日期、作者以及注释是否已解析的信息也很容易获得。
超链接是将用户指向工作簿内位置的引用,帮助他们打开本地文件或访问外部网站。您可以在文档的工作表中添加、删除、编辑和搜索超链接。
命名范围是为其分配名称的单个单元格或多个单元格的范围。它们允许用户多次引用相同的单元格范围,或者在公式中合并预定义的单元格范围。可以在工作簿和工作表级别上使用指定范围。可以在工作簿和工作表级别上使用指定范围。
“冻结窗格”允许用户冻结任意数量的行和列,以便在工作表的任何位置都能看到它们。
SpreadProcessing分组功能有助于将工作表数据组织成部分。你可以对行或列进行分组,突出显示相关信息,比较不同的数据,或者将分散你注意力的内容折叠起来。
WinForms的SpreadProcessing过滤功能允许你在工作表中设置各种预定义的和自定义的过滤器。开箱即用,您可以按值或值的范围、按特定时间段(上个月、上季度、去年)筛选电子表格数据,或者使用顶部、底部、高于和低于平均值的高级过滤器对数据进行排序。您还可以使用填充和预色过滤器按颜色进行过滤。
RadSpreadProcessing中过滤支持的文档排序功能允许您创建和修改排序规则,并将它们应用于电子表格的各个部分。用户可以按升序和降序、颜色以及使用自定义排序逻辑对数据进行排序。
数据验证通过控制允许用户进入单元格的数据类型或值,帮助您确保数据质量和数据准确性。您可以为文本长度、数字和日期指定规则,为下拉列表预定义值,或使用公式自定义条件。
查找和替换api提供了在电子表格文档中查找替换文本和数字的功能。高度可定制的Find功能允许您定义要搜索的内容、在文档中搜索它的位置以及如何处理区分大小写的数据、单个和多次出现的数据以及是返回公式还是返回结果值。Replace API允许将查找结果替换为所需的值。
您可以将两个或多个相邻的单元格合并为跨越多行和多列的单个单元格。
页面设置定义了工作表在打印或导出为PDF时的外观。设置和获取页眉和页脚设置,并应用各种页面设置选项,如纸张大小、方向、页边距、换行符、缩放以适应单个页面上的行和列等等。
在工作簿内或跨工作簿添加或复制工作表、单元格和单元格范围。您可以通过指定格式选项(如粘贴值、公式、控件号和可视格式等)来微调粘贴内容的外观。
您可以禁用对工作簿结构的修改。这样,用户就不能添加、删除、重命名或重新排序表。
锁定工作表的内容和结构,以限制用户可以进行的修改类型。您可以指定启用保护时用户可以使用的命令。
您可以保护工作表的内容和结构。通过可用的选项,您可以有选择地允许或限制用户进行诸如编辑单元格、插入和删除列以及插入和删除行之类的更改。
确保整个工作簿的单元格格式一致。样式可以一次性对单元格应用一组格式化特征,比如字体、字体大小、边框、对齐方式等。您可以选择应用内置样式或创建自己的样式。
WinForms SpreadProcessing库完全符合联邦信息处理标准(FIPS),确保您可以创建符合FIPS 140-2标准的文档。
文档模型提供了几个预定义的主题,称为文档主题。每个主题都允许您指定可以应用于整个工作簿外观的颜色、字体和各种图形效果。